Nick, do you mind if I send a Loom video as my default cold email strategy?

The Loom video approach was terrible for me. My other approach was sending a lead magnet (a Google doc). To reconcile scale with customization, there are two approaches: low volume, high customization—sending a personalized Loom video that solves a problem, delivers value, and builds a warm connection to maybe 10‑30 people a day; and high volume, low result—blasting a generic “do you mind if I send you a Loom video?” to a million people and only recording when they reply. The latter is overdone and saturated; it’s not effective anymore.

Can you explain your advice on using Loom videos in cold emails and provide a demo?

Using Loom videos in cold emails works and can be effective, but it lowers deliverability because links and media trigger spam filters. You trade volume for personalization—send fewer, highly tailored emails with a Loom video that shows you’ve already built the asset, which creates a pattern break and raises perceived value. To compensate for lower deliverability, reduce volume or improve mailbox practices. It’s not fully scalable like pure text cold email, but it’s a valuable tactic when you need to stand out.

How many of my daily cold emails should include a Loom video versus text or lead magnets?

Treat personalized video outreach as a separate campaign from your regular cold email. For the video campaign, gather prospects using Apollo or social‑media scrapers, then send customized DMs that reference specifics from their profiles or websites so it’s clearly not a template. Keep your standard cold email process distinct. Within that flow, I’d record a Loom video for about five to twenty prospects per day — enough to add a personal touch without overwhelming your workload — and run the video outreach alongside your usual cold email sequence.

Can you show how to set up a cold email campaign with Loom videos for each outreach?

I don’t run a fully automated cold‑email system with Loom videos because it doesn’t scale well. Instead, I keep a simple Google sheet with columns for first name, last name, company, email, icebreaker, and a Loom link. I add each lead to the sheet, automate the icebreaker, then manually record a short Loom video (2‑4 minutes) for each prospect, talking about their specific needs. Sending 15 personalized videos takes about an hour of recording plus an hour to set up—so it’s doable but not highly scalable. The nuance is that customized Loom videos conflict with the goal of high‑volume automated outreach; the best approach is to do the recordings yourself when you want that level of personalization.
